Eric Cosper Joins The Distillery Project as Creative Director

 

By The Chicago Egotist / /

Independent, creative and strategic agency The Distillery Project (TDP) has hired Eric Cosper as creative director. He will work on the agency’s Arrow Electronics and Ferguson Enterprises accounts and new business. Hewill report to Founder/Chief Creative Officer John Condon.

Cosper believes every marketing problem is a creative puzzle waiting to be solved with a simple, well-crafted idea. Agencies he’s worked at include Wieden+Kennedy, BBDO, and Fallon, where he’s worked on such brands as Nike, ESPN, GE, Citibank, Coca-Cola, and T-Mobile. He’s picked up every award in the industry and even an Emmy nomination for his “Brilliant Machines” work for GE. His work on Charles Schwab, CitiBank and GE have been awarded Effies. Cosper also knows the power of an idea can move business.

“Eric has worked on a wide variety of some of the world’s best-known brands at some very highly regarded agencies,” said John Condon, founder/CCO. “He brings a wealth of experience, along with a proven ability to create ideas and craft them in a way that demands consideration. And on top of that, he’s a really good guy. We’re very happy to have him on our team.”

Founded in April 2012, Chicago based TDP is dedicated to giving its clients more of what they want and less of what they don’t. TDP specializes in clear, sharply refined thinking and a powerful brand of creativity driven by ideas simple, pure and potent enough to change the way people think, how they feel, and even what they do. TDP was named an Ad Age Small Agency of the Year three times in the last decade. In addition to Arrow Electronics and Ferguson Enterprises, clients of TDP include Meijer, Caterpillar and Fresh Thyme.
